云计算服务器模块拆解与智能运行机制
云计算服务器拆解:从硬件架构到运行机制的深度解析
在数字化时代,云计算服务器已经成为支撑大数据处理、企业信息化和智能服务的核心载体。一个典型的云计算服务器并非单一设备,而是由多个模块协同工作的复杂系统。本文将从硬件架构、虚拟化技术、资源调度逻辑三个维度,系统性拆解云计算服务器的运行原理,并探讨其实际应用中的技术价值。
一、物理层架构:云端计算的基石
1.1 高密度服务器集群
现代云计算服务器通常采用模块化设计,核心硬件包括超大规模服务器组、分布式存储节点和高速网络设备。这类服务器普遍搭载多路处理器架构,单机可支持数十个物理CPU核心,配合RDIMM/HoMARDIMM内存技术,实现每秒数TB级的数据吞吐能力。散热系统通过2.5英寸硬盘托架优化和液冷模块进行智能温控。
1.2 存储阵列与容灾方案
分布式存储系统采用Ceph、Swift等开源架构,通过RAID 6及软件定义存储技术,实现PB级数据存储。三副本机制保障数据可靠性,纠删码技术将存储开销控制在30%以下。NVMe SSD与HDD的混配使用,确保了热数据访问延迟低于0.5ms。
1.3 高速互联网络
采用25/100Gbps以太网与InfiniBand混合架构,通过ECMP(Equal-Cost Multi-Path)技术实现链路聚合。BGP路由协议确保跨数据中心通信时延不超过1.2ms,SDN控制器动态调整网络拓扑,支持实时弹性扩容。
二、虚拟化技术层:资源抽象的魔法
2.1 虚拟化引擎架构
基于KVM/Hyper-V/Xen等裸金属hypervisor,通过硬件辅助虚拟化(VT-x/AMD-V)将物理资源抽象为多个独立虚拟机实例。每个虚拟机通过VMM(虚拟机监控器)与物理硬件交互,内存隔离采用影子页表技术,确保关键数据访问安全。
2.2 容器化部署机制
Docker与Kubernetes的结合实现了应用解耦。容器镜像大小控制在500MB以内,通过cri-o运行时优化启动时间至秒级。网络插件Calico/Cilium赋能跨主机容器通信,服务网格技术实现流量治理与灰度发布。
2.3 异构计算支持
GPU虚拟化方案支持单物理卡划分多个vGPU实例,Triton推理服务器调度框架可同时处理TensorRT、ONNX Runtime等不同模型格式。FPGA加速卡通过OPAE框架实现任务卸载,特定算法性能提升可达8倍。
三、智能调度系统:云端资源的神经中枢
3.1 动态负载均衡
基于时间序列预测的弹性伸缩控制器,采用ARIMA模型预判业务峰值。自动伸缩策略支持CPU利用率达到75%时触发扩容,资源回收阈值设置为15%使用率,确保资源利用率始终维持在60%-70%的最佳区间。
3.2 分布式任务调度
Apache Mesos与YARN调度器采用多维资源感知机制(CPU、内存、GPU、通信带宽),通过抢占式调度算法处理突发任务请求。任务容器化后支持卷快照功能,跨节点迁移耗时控制在300ms内。
3.3 智能运维系统
AIOps平台通过SNMP/IPMI/DMI协议采集硬件 Provincial指标,结合Elasticsearch构建全量日志库。自学习故障预测模型基于LSTM神经网络,可提前12-24小时预警硬件异常,MTTR(平均修复时间)较传统方案缩短60%。
四、安全架构:云端防护的三维体系
物理安全层采用门禁生物识别与视频监控双验证机制,机房功耗监控系统实时检测异常用电模式。逻辑防护方面,TLS 1.3协议保障数据链路安全,mTLS服务间通信方案实现双向身份认证。通过TEGRA(可信执行环境)构建安全容器,金融级交易系统可达到NCSC-CNI/IS0-15408认证标准。
结语:云技术演进的未来方向
云计算服务器的技术革新正呈现两大趋势:基于AI的预测式运维将故障处理前移,而量子加密技术的工程化应用将重构数据安全边界。随着5.5G网络部署,边缘云服务器的模组化设计与极低时延需求,将持续推动算力基础设施向更精细化、智能化方向发展。理解这一体系的运行逻辑,既是数字化转型的必修课,也是把握技术变革机遇的关键钥匙。